      Hey folks, recently bought two argus 2 cameras from amazon.

      One of the cameras I've inserted a SanDisk micro sd card, 32gb.

      However, when "purposely" creating events to test the recording functionality, I'm unable to actually view the recorded footage via the app?

      Even after waiting a few minutes for the "footage" to fully complete, when I try and download and play it back, I just keep getting "download failed" errors.

      Thanks, Naweed.

          I bought this microsd card today and seems to have worked.

          I can now see the footage recorded on the sd card via the app.

          https://www.amazon.co.uk/gp/aw/d/B07CY3QSST?psc=1&ref=ppx_pop_mob_b_asin_title

          I believe "endurance" specific microsd cards are the best for this sort of thing.
